[mod] refactoring: processors
Report to the user suspended engines. searx.search.processor.abstract: * manages suspend time (per network). * reports suspended time to the ResultContainer (method extend_container_if_suspended) * adds the results to the ResultContainer (method extend_container) * handles exceptions (method handle_exception)
